Common Challenges and How to Overcome Them
Many survivors of sexual assault in Pennsylvania face significant challenges when pursuing justice, often due to the sensitive nature of their cases. One of the primary obstacles is the fear and stigma associated with coming forward. Many victims may hesitate to report the crime out of embarrassment, guilt, or concern for their reputation, which can delay critical legal steps. Overcoming this requires a supportive environment where survivors feel empowered to speak up without judgment. Legal aid organizations and dedicated sexual assault lawyers in Pennsylvania play a vital role in creating such spaces, offering confidential consultations and ensuring victims understand their rights.
Another common challenge is the complex legal process itself. Sexual assault cases often involve intricate procedures, including evidence collection, expert testimony, and navigating various legal statutes of limitations. Survivors may feel overwhelmed by the technical aspects, leading to potential mistakes that could hinder their case. Here, having an experienced sexual assault lawyer in Pennsylvania becomes invaluable. These attorneys are equipped with the knowledge and skills to guide survivors through the process, ensuring every step is taken correctly, and their rights are protected throughout.
